Secure TV Enclosure for Ligature Control
In healthcare and correctional facilities, the risk of patient or inmate self-harm is a serious concern. TVs often present a potential ligature hazard, as cords, wires, and mounting brackets can be misused. To address this risk, secure TV enclosures are essential for creating a safe environment. TV Safety Against Ligature Hazards
In settings where risk management is paramount, ensuring the safety of patients and residents is a top priority. One often overlooked area is television equipment, which can pose a potential ligature hazard if not properly addressed.
